# Quotas: Rinseline Locker Access Flow

This page documents the enforced limits for Rinseline's laundry-locker unlock flow. Each unlock request mints a single-use token bound to one locker door; tokens are invalidated on first use or on expiry, whichever comes first. Rate limits apply per fob to prevent brute-force sweeps across locker banks, and offline grants are queued with a bounded retry horizon. Reviewers should verify any code change keeps these invariants intact. The enforced constants are as follows.

tuning constants:
QUOTAS = {
    "druwyn": 5,
    "holix": 5,
    "zorath": 5,
    "holwyn": 10,
}

## Deploying the Gatewick Proctor Queue

Deploys are pretty painless: push to main, wait for the pipeline, then watch the queue drain dashboard for five minutes. If candidates pile up mid-exam, roll back first and ask questions later — the queue replays safely. Everything the workers care about lives in one config block, shown here for reference.

settings of bafof-yagef:
JOROX_PIN=8740
JOROX_TENANT=pelox
JOROX_METRICS_HOST=metrics.jorox.qorvelworks.internal
JOROX_SEAL=seal_c78f63c1
JOROX_STANDBY_TEAM=norax

Subject: Handover — fan-out backpressure fix

Hey folks,

Quick note before I'm out: the notification fan-out in Pingdrift kept choking under load, so we added backpressure at the queue layer. Support may see delayed-but-not-dropped alerts for a day or two — that's expected. If you need to redeploy the worker pool, use the standard script. The signing key you'll need for that deploy is right below.

rollout seal: bky4_x7Gc

Capacity note for the Fennelgrid sidecar review. Aggregation window widened to cut emit rate; per-pod memory ceiling holds at current cardinality (~12k series). CPU flat. Risk: buffer overflow if a tenant spikes labels — mitigated by the drop policy. No node-pool changes needed for the Caldermoor cluster this quarter. Review the flush and buffer settings before merge. Constants under review are below.

limits module of yafop-hahag:
QUOTAS = {
    "tamwyn": 652,
    "prawyn": 731,
}